Schuiten and Peeters win prize at “Paris Se Livre”

François Schuiten and Benoît Peeters have won the Prix Tour Montparnasse in the category Beaux-Livres for their book Revoir Paris, l’Exposition during the 7th edition of PARIS SE LIVRE 1).

PARIS SE LIVRE is a yearly event held at the 56th floor of the Montparnasse Tower. PARIS SE LIVRE is an event organized at the initiative of the Mayor of the 15th arrondissement and l’Ensemble Immobilier Tour Maine-Montparnasse, in partnership with the l’association ACE 15 and the library Le Divan et Zellige. This year PARIS SE LIVRE is organized from June 4 until June 6, 2015.

As every year, the highest library in the capital opens its doors to an unusual or romantic Paris, a historic Paris or mysterious, current and modern Paris, through fine arts, literature, history, thriller, urbanism, comics and children's books … An opportunity for all kind of meetings, discussions, literary exchanges and dedications with a wide range of authors.

In 2014, the Fine Arts prize was awarded to “Paris 1914-1918 : la guerre au quotidien” with photographs by Charles Lansiaux (ed Paris libraries.). The prize of the Parisian Artistic Life in the category Fine Books 2015 will once again make us discover the facets of the world of arts and culture.

This years jury members were: Patrick Abisseror, président de la commission communication de l’EITMM et directeur de Montparnasse56 ; Sylvie Buisson, auteur ; Christian Giudicelli, écrivain, éditeur, critique littéraire et membre du jury du prix Renaudot ; Sylvie Granet, de UES GAIA, pour la SCI PHILGEN Tour Montparnasse ; Roberto Iaia, de la librairie Le Divan ; Hélène Macé de Lépinay ; ancienne adjointe au Maire de Paris ; Josyane Savigneau, auteur, critique, journaliste au Monde ; Amélie Simier, directrice et conservateur du Musée Bourdelle et du Musée Zadkine ; Pierre Vavasseur, auteur, journaliste (Le Parisien, France Inter ; Gilles Vuillemard, directeur immobilier MGEN.

The prizes were presented by Douglas Kennedy, godfather of the 2015 edition of PARIS SE LIVRE. Douglas Kennedy mentioned “Revoir Paris, ce livre absolument magnifique”.

Paris en bande dessinée

On Saturday June 6, 2015 an event will be held with the title “Paris en bande dessinée”. This event will start at 16hrs. François Schuiten and Benoît Peeters will attend this event together with Eric Puech & Gilles Schlesser (Rose de Paris, 1925) and Nadja (Les Filles de Montparnasse, Tome 4).

Afterwards Schuiten and Peeters will sign their albums.
